如何在“中配置文件夹访问”;文件及;媒体Portlet“;按liferay中的组织划分?

如何在“中配置文件夹访问”;文件及;媒体Portlet“;按liferay中的组织划分?,liferay,liferay-6,document,folder-permissions,Liferay,Liferay 6,Document,Folder Permissions,我想添加一个部分,允许客户在门户网站上载/下载文件(创建目录)。文件/目录应该存储在文件服务器上,而我们应该能够在LifeRay中设置根文件夹。 榜样\\。其中客户作为一个组织。Liferay版本是6.2 一个客户的用户创建的文件夹目录/文档不应被其他客户的用户访问 我们的结构如下: 客户A=组织A 用户A1(组织管理员) 用户A2(用户) 要上载文档的目录名=“客户A” 客户B=组织B 用户B1(组织管理员) 用户B2(在文档介质中查看、写入访问权限) 用户B3(视图访问) 要上载文档的

我想添加一个部分,允许客户在门户网站上载/下载文件(创建目录)。文件/目录应该存储在文件服务器上,而我们应该能够在LifeRay中设置根文件夹。 榜样<代码>\\。其中客户作为一个组织。Liferay版本是6.2

一个客户的用户创建的文件夹目录/文档不应被其他客户的用户访问

我们的结构如下:

  • 客户A=组织A
    • 用户A1(组织管理员)
    • 用户A2(用户)
    • 要上载文档的目录名=“客户A”
  • 客户B=组织B
    • 用户B1(组织管理员)
    • 用户B2(在文档介质中查看、写入访问权限)
    • 用户B3(视图访问)
    • 要上载文档的目录名=“客户B”
  • 当“客户A”的任何用户上载任何文档时,文档可见范围应仅在“组织A”内,与组织B相同

    所有用户将使用单个网站共享内容。 我曾尝试按组织创建一个网站团队,然后设置对相应文件夹的访问权限,但不起作用。此外,我还尝试创建一个不同的组织角色,并将其分配给各自的组织用户


    我可以通过配置来实现这一点,还是需要进行定制开发

    您是否尝试创建一个常规角色,然后将其分配给组织?我不知道它是否会自动正确设置权限,但如果我正确理解Liferay,创建该文件的用户应该能够为其设置权限。如果他们这样做了,那么只有具有分配给他们组织的常规角色的用户才能看到它

    设置组织角色的问题(至少从我对
    Liferay,如果我误解了Liferay的权限,请纠正我)权限仅适用于一个特定的组织,而不适用于其他组织,因此他们仍然可以看到它。

    感谢您的回答,我使用创建组织网站,所以特定于该站点的目录可以被组织的用户或站点的成员访问。